Breaking Down American Airlines Trip Credits
What are American Airlines Trip Credits? American Airlines trip credits are issued when flights are canceled or significantly changed by the airline, or when a passenger cancels their flight and is eligible for a credit instead of a refund. These credits are typically issued as an electronic value and can be used towards future American Airlines flights, including taxes and fees. Crucially, they often come with different expiration dates than standard AA vouchers, requiring careful attention to avoid forfeiture.
Purpose and Core Functionality: Trip credits serve as a flexible alternative to refunds, allowing passengers to rebook flights at their convenience without paying additional change fees. Their core functionality revolves around offering a seamless way to reschedule travel, mitigating the financial and logistical burdens of unexpected flight disruptions. Understanding this core purpose is paramount to effective utilization.
How to Find Your Trip Credit: Your trip credit will usually be emailed to you following a cancellation or change. Alternatively, you can find it by logging into your AAdvantage account on the American Airlines website. Look for the "My Trips" or "My Account" section. The credit will have a unique identification number which is crucial for its application.
Exploring the Depth of American Airlines Trip Credits
Booking with Trip Credits: The process of booking with trip credits is relatively straightforward, although it can vary slightly depending on whether you're booking online or through customer service. When booking online, ensure you select the option to apply your trip credit during the payment stage. The system will typically automatically detect available credits linked to your AAdvantage account. If not, be prepared to input the credit's unique identification number. Using the American Airlines app is a convenient and efficient method for managing and utilizing your trip credit.
Understanding Expiration Dates: Pay meticulous attention to the expiration date of your trip credit. These dates vary, and credits can expire much sooner than initially anticipated. Plan your travel accordingly to avoid losing the value of your credit. Always check your credit details online or through your email confirmation to confirm the expiration date.
Transferability and Sharing: Generally, American Airlines trip credits are non-transferable. They are linked to the specific AAdvantage account to which they were originally issued. There are no options for sharing or transferring these credits to other passengers.
Using Trip Credits for Upgrades: While primarily designed for flight purchases, trip credits can sometimes be applied toward upgrades, depending on the specific terms and conditions of the credit. This may require contacting American Airlines customer service to confirm eligibility.
Redeeming on Partner Airlines: Unfortunately, trip credits are typically only redeemable on American Airlines flights and not on flights operated by partner airlines. This is a crucial point often overlooked, so always double-check the terms and conditions.
FAQ: Decoding American Airlines Trip Credits
What does an American Airlines trip credit do? It allows you to rebook a flight on American Airlines using the value of a cancelled or changed flight.
How does it influence my travel plans? It offers flexibility and avoids additional change fees, providing a safety net for unexpected travel disruptions.
Is it always a direct replacement for a refund? Not always. Sometimes you may only be eligible for a trip credit even if you'd prefer a cash refund. Read the fine print carefully.
What happens if I don't use my trip credit before it expires? You forfeit the value of the credit. Make sure to redeem it before its expiration date.
Is a trip credit the same as an eCredits? While similar in function, there may be subtle differences in the terms and conditions. Review the specific details of your credit carefully.
